Acts 11:15-16
"“As I began to speak,” Peter continued, “the Holy Spirit fell on them, just as he fell on us at the beginning.
Then I thought of the Lord’s words when he said, ‘John baptized with water, but you will be baptized with the Holy Spirit.’
Peter stated the whole affair to Brethren in Jerusalem. We should at all times bear with the infirmities of our brethren; and instead of taking offence, or answering with warmth, we should explain our motives, and show the nature of our proceedings.
That preaching is certainly right, with which the HOLY STIRIT is given.
While men are very zealous for their own regulations, they should take care that they do not withstand GOD; and those who love the LORD will glorify HIM, when made sure that HE has given repentance to life to any fellow-sinners.
Repentance is GOD'S gift; HIS grace takes away the heart of stone, and gives us a heart of flesh. Giving reference to Pentecost also reminded them of GOD'S Grace and fulfillment of GOD'S promises about HOLY SPIRIT baptism. This passage teaches us about the grace of GOD, that is impartial.
And when some Brethren seem not to understand the new thing, that the LORD has done, we shouldn't take offense on their ignorance. Amen.
